Today, few commercial fishing operations remain in Lake Ontario. The few commercial fishers on the lake today operate under strict regulations governed by the US and Canadian governments. Most fishing on Lake Ontario today is done by recreational …

Each species has its own limits and restrictions for what you can … fmc 8040-lsWebJan 15, 2024 · The Best Time To Fish Ontario Rivers By Species. Brown Trout – Trout Opener to July 1st. Brook Trout – Trout Opener to June 15th. Spring Steelhead – March 15 to May 15. Fall Steelhead – October 15 to December 15. Salmon – September, and October. Migratory Brown trout – October – November. Bass – late June to September. greensboro nc hvac technicianWeb2 days ago · Fishing regulators need more transparency, ocean groups say.
